I have a few stupid questions, are black worms sold at a bait shop, are they dead or alive, and are they like night crawlers?

not a stupid question as some of the terms used in the trade and also at fishing stores can be confusing and refer to different items.

as far as i know most bait stores don't carry live blackworms. live blackworms are generally purchased at an LFS or in bulk from a distributor. they are very small (maybe an inch or so) oligochaete worms...related to earthworms but much skinnier and smaller. they are a great source of nutrition for young fishes, old fishes, and stubborn (in terms of eating) fishes.

mixing up the african arow's diet with blackworms and other food items at this stage will keep them growing steadily as well as keep them very healthy and thick (they often arrive skinny when initially purchased from an LFS or supplier since they are usually around 2-3" long and generally not consistently eating while being held for shipping, etc).
